1 // SPDX-License-Identifier: GPL-2.0+
2 /*
3  * Copyright 2008 - 2009 Windriver, <www.windriver.com>
4  * Author: Tom Rix <Tom.Rix@windriver.com>
5  *
6  * (C) Copyright 2014 Linaro, Ltd.
7  * Rob Herring <robh@kernel.org>
8  */
9 #include <common.h>
10 #include <command.h>
11 #include <console.h>
12 #include <g_dnl.h>
13 #include <fastboot.h>
14 #include <net.h>
15 #include <usb.h>
16
17 static int do_fastboot_udp(int argc, char *const argv[],
18                            uintptr_t buf_addr, size_t buf_size)
19 {
20 #if CONFIG_IS_ENABLED(UDP_FUNCTION_FASTBOOT)
21         int err = net_loop(FASTBOOT);
22
23         if (err < 0) {
24                 printf("fastboot udp error: %d\n", err);
25                 return CMD_RET_FAILURE;
26         }
27
28         return CMD_RET_SUCCESS;
29 #else
30         pr_err("Fastboot UDP not enabled\n");
31         return CMD_RET_FAILURE;
32 #endif
33 }
34
35 static int do_fastboot_usb(int argc, char *const argv[],
36                            uintptr_t buf_addr, size_t buf_size)
37 {
38 #if CONFIG_IS_ENABLED(USB_FUNCTION_FASTBOOT)
39         int controller_index;
40         char *usb_controller;
41         int ret;
42
43         if (argc < 2)
44                 return CMD_RET_USAGE;
45
46         usb_controller = argv[1];
47         controller_index = simple_strtoul(usb_controller, NULL, 0);
48
49         ret = board_usb_init(controller_index, USB_INIT_DEVICE);
50         if (ret) {
51                 pr_err("USB init failed: %d\n", ret);
52                 return CMD_RET_FAILURE;
53         }
54
55         g_dnl_clear_detach();
56         ret = g_dnl_register("usb_dnl_fastboot");
57         if (ret)
58                 return ret;
59
60         if (!g_dnl_board_usb_cable_connected()) {
61                 puts("\rUSB cable not detected.\n" \
62                      "Command exit.\n");
63                 ret = CMD_RET_FAILURE;
64                 goto exit;
65         }
66
67         while (1) {
68                 if (g_dnl_detach())
69                         break;
70                 if (ctrlc())
71                         break;
72                 usb_gadget_handle_interrupts(controller_index);
73         }
74
75         ret = CMD_RET_SUCCESS;
76
77 exit:
78         g_dnl_unregister();
79         g_dnl_clear_detach();
80         board_usb_cleanup(controller_index, USB_INIT_DEVICE);
81
82         return ret;
83 #else
84         pr_err("Fastboot USB not enabled\n");
85         return CMD_RET_FAILURE;
86 #endif
87 }
88
89 static int do_fastboot(cmd_tbl_t *cmdtp, int flag, int argc, char *const argv[])
90 {
91         uintptr_t buf_addr = (uintptr_t)NULL;
92         size_t buf_size = 0;
93
94         if (argc < 2)
95                 return CMD_RET_USAGE;
96
97         while (argc > 1 && **(argv + 1) == '-') {
98                 char *arg = *++argv;
99
100                 --argc;
101                 while (*++arg) {
102                         switch (*arg) {
103                         case 'l':
104                                 if (--argc <= 0)
105                                         return CMD_RET_USAGE;
106                                 buf_addr = simple_strtoul(*++argv, NULL, 16);
107                                 goto NXTARG;
108
109                         case 's':
110                                 if (--argc <= 0)
111                                         return CMD_RET_USAGE;
112                                 buf_size = simple_strtoul(*++argv, NULL, 16);
113                                 goto NXTARG;
114
115                         default:
116                                 return CMD_RET_USAGE;
117                         }
118                 }
119 NXTARG:
120                 ;
121         }
122
123         fastboot_init((void *)buf_addr, buf_size);
124
125         if (!strcmp(argv[1], "udp"))
126                 return do_fastboot_udp(argc, argv, buf_addr, buf_size);
127
128         if (!strcmp(argv[1], "usb")) {
129                 argv++;
130                 argc--;
131         }
132
133         return do_fastboot_usb(argc, argv, buf_addr, buf_size);
134 }
135
136 #ifdef CONFIG_SYS_LONGHELP
137 static char fastboot_help_text[] =
138         "[-l addr] [-s size] usb <controller> | udp\n"
139         "\taddr - address of buffer used during data transfers ("
140         __stringify(CONFIG_FASTBOOT_BUF_ADDR) ")\n"
141         "\tsize - size of buffer used during data transfers ("
142         __stringify(CONFIG_FASTBOOT_BUF_SIZE) ")"
143         ;
144 #endif
145
146 U_BOOT_CMD(
147         fastboot, CONFIG_SYS_MAXARGS, 1, do_fastboot,
148         "run as a fastboot usb or udp device", fastboot_help_text
149 );
